Confirmed examination dates, registration windows and any policy updates are published by AMC at https://www.amc.org.au/assessment/amc-cat-examination. Always verify your sitting date and deadlines against the college's own page before making travel or leave arrangements.

The AMC CAT is a computer-adaptive examination delivered year-round through approved test centres. Candidates select an available sitting at the time of registration rather than working to a single fixed exam date. For current availability, fees and registration steps, see the official AMC CAT page.

How far in advance should I register?

Registration windows typically open months before each sitting and close weeks before the examination date. Late registration is often not permitted or attracts a surcharge.

How should I plan study leave around the exam?

Most candidates take the bulk of study leave in the final 4 to 8 weeks before sitting, with shorter blocks earlier in preparation. Speak to your training program early because leave allocation is finite.

What if the date changes after I register?

Reschedule policies vary by college. The official examination page sets out the current policy for date changes, fee transfers and any extenuating circumstances provisions.
